It\u2019s predicted that at least the same number again will stop smoking thanks to vaping in 2016.&nbsp;In total, the Office for National <a href=\"\/vaping-statistics\">Statistics<\/a> has found that 863,000 current vapers are ex-smokers.<\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Smoking kills about half the people that do it, taking <\/span><a href=\"http:\/\/www.cdc.gov\/tobacco\/data_statistics\/fact_sheets\/health_effects\/tobacco_related_mortality\/\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">ten years off the average smoker\u2019s lifespan<\/span><\/a><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">. But vaping, which contains neither the carbon monoxide or the tar which makes smoking so lethal, is estimated to be around <\/span><a href=\"https:\/\/www.gov.uk\/government\/news\/e-cigarettes-around-95-less-harmful-than-tobacco-estimates-landmark-review\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">95% less harmful than smoking by Public Health England<\/span><\/a><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">. The <\/span><a href=\"http:\/\/www.bbc.com\/news\/health-36139618\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Royal College of Physicians (RCP) has issued a report saying that smokers should be \u201cencouraged\u201d and \u201creassured\u201d that vaping<\/span><\/a><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> is much less harmful than smoking. They came to three main conclusions on e-cigarettes:<\/span><\/p>\n<ol>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">E-cigarettes are not \u201ca gateway\u201d to smoking<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">E-cigarettes are not re-normalising smoking<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">E-cigarettes can help smokers quit tobacco completely<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ol>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Professor John Britton, who advises the RCP on tobacco issues, said that e-cigarettes have the potential to prevent premature death and disease caused by smoking. He went on to stress the fact that even long-term vaping is likely to be nowhere near as harmful as the long-term inhalation of carbon monoxide (smoking).<\/span><\/p>\n<h2>British Charities Agree that Vaping can Save Lives<\/h2>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Two well-respected charities, the British Heart Foundation (BMF) and Cancer Research UK, welcomed the RCP\u2019s findings. Dr Mike Knapton of the BMF said that the <\/span><a href=\"http:\/\/ash.org.uk\/files\/documents\/ASH_116.pdf\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">70% of British smokers that want to quit<\/span><\/a><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> could try to do so by using e-cigarettes. He said that e-cigarettes are \u201can effective way of reducing the harm (caused by smoking)\u201d. <\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">According to the <\/span><a href=\"http:\/\/health.spectator.co.uk\/public-health-should-step-aside-vapers-are-now-leading-the-way-against-smoking\/\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Office for National Statistics (ONS), 863,000 current e-cigarette users are ex-smokers<\/span><\/a><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">. That\u2019s an enormous number of people who have dramatically cut their risk of an early smoking-related death thanks to vaping. In addition, a further 720,000 people have managed to quit both cigarettes and e-cigarettes, showing that vapers are not simply swapping one addiction for another.
